I think ... (depending on which game mode and the purpose of you build) that you should choose between power damage or condition damage first.

Then comes the weapon choice:

  • PowerDual Sword + StaffSword/AXE + hammer

  • COnditionShortbow + Mace/axe

Then trait line

  • PowerDevastation + invocation works best

  • COnditionFirst.... corruption mandatoryTHen you can pick either devastation (for team ferocity buff) or invocation (if you want better energy management)

That would be way more effective i think if you do this first :) then just try some different trait combination.
